The University of Teacher Education Fribourg, founded in 2001, is a public institution of higher education seated in Fribourg, Switzerland. In its capacity as a teacher education university, it offers a study program for prospective teachers at pre-primary and primary schools which is conducted both in German and English; the program culminates in a teaching diploma as well as a Bachelor of Arts in Pre-primary and Primary Education. Moreover, the University, in partnership with the University of Fribourg, provides teacher education at secondary level I (subjects: Technical Design and Housekeeping). Also on offer are continuing education courses in Languages, Mathematics and Natural Science, Culture and Society, Music, Art and Design, Movement and Physical Education, Media and ICT, as well as School and Development. The University’s educational portfolio is rounded off by the CAS courses “Managing Internships – Developing Lessons – Leading a Team“, “Teaching Coaching and Intervention“, “Médiation scolaire“, as well as “Managing and Leading Schools“.
